Technical Description

In the Linux kernel, the following vulnerability has been resolved:

RDMA/core: always drop device refcount in ib_del_sub_device_and_put()

Since nldev_deldev() (introduced by commit 060c642b2ab8 ("RDMA/nldev: Add

support to add/delete a sub IB device through netlink") grabs a reference

using ib_device_get_by_index() before calling ib_del_sub_device_and_put(),

we need to drop that reference before returning -EOPNOTSUPP error.

Affected Products

Vendor Product Versions Status
linux linux_kernel >= 6.11, < 6.12.64 Affected
